Output 7c1bd07830609d60667cc35fb0cfee642db5eb5454e73a6610d1ce451ce9350f:0

value
545950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deb5debdf9dd05a2656fd9ad4b1c7e3d649116ac OP_EQUAL
address
3MzboghPdhKSwgoLG4Sk9W35t65Hay8BJU
transaction
7c1bd07830609d60667cc35fb0cfee642db5eb5454e73a6610d1ce451ce9350f
confirmations
290684
spent
true